The treatment uses mesenchymal stem cells extracted from a patient’s own bone marrow or fat tissue and reinjected into damaged areas of the knee on the same day. This autologous approach is intended to reduce the risk of immune rejection while supporting the body’s natural healing response in cartilage and surrounding tissue.
